Vonage Regional CCaaS Specialist/Channel Manager

A Vonage Regional CCaaS Specialist/Channel Manager is responsible for developing and executing strategies to drive revenue growth through channel partners specializing in Vonage’s CCaaS and AI solutions. This pivotal role involves recruiting, enabling, and managing a named list of regional CCaaS partners, building robust relationships, and ensuring they are fully equipped to sell and support Vonage's comprehensive portfolio of CCaaS products, including Intelligent Workspace.Key Responsibilities

  • Channel Partner Management: Build and maintain strong relationships with new and existing channel partners, including active recruitment, seamless onboarding, and providing continuous support and comprehensive training.
  • Strategic Planning: Create and implement effective channel partner strategies to expand Vonage's Customer Experience (CX) footprint and drive widespread adoption of Vonage's CX solutions.
  • Sales Enablement & Training: Equip partners with the necessary training, tools, and resources to effectively sell Vonage's CX products, covering sales training, marketing support, and technical enablement.
  • Pipeline and Performance Management: Accurately track sales pipeline, bookings, and other critical key performance indicators (KPIs) to measure the effectiveness of channel partnerships and proactively identify areas for continuous improvement.
  • Cross-Functional Collaboration: Work closely with internal teams, including Sales, Marketing, and Product Development, to align channel strategies, accelerate product adoption, and ensure partner success.
  • Market Expertise: Maintain a deep understanding of the competitive CX landscape, including contact center software, emerging industry trends, and relevant regulatory requirements.

Skills and Qualifications

  • Experience: 5+ years of demonstrable experience in channel management within the Contact Center as a Service (CCaaS) industry.
  • CCaaS Expertise: Deep knowledge of modern contact center solutions, including Workforce Optimization (WFO), Workforce Engagement Management (WEM), Artificial Intelligence (AI), and advanced analytics.
  • Sales Acumen: Proven ability to successfully build and execute channel sales strategies, develop detailed business plans, and consistently drive revenue growth.
  • Communication Skills: Excellent communication, compelling presentation, and strong interpersonal skills to effectively engage with both partners and internal teams.
  • Technical Proficiency: A solid understanding of business telephony, cloud solutions, and other relevant technologies that underpin CCaaS.
  • Relationship Building: Exceptional ability to forge strong, productive relationships with channel partners and key internal stakeholders.

In essence, the Vonage CCaaS Channel Manager serves as the critical bridge between Vonage and its channel partners, directly driving revenue growth by empowering partners to effectively sell and support Vonage's innovative CCaaS solutions.
